5. Slide the new hot-swap hard disk drive into the drive bay from the front until it snaps into position

and then completely close the handle.

Figure 94. Installing the hot-swap hard disk drive

6. Check the hot-swap hard-disk-drive status LEDs to ensure that the hard disk drive is operating correctly.

You might have to restart the server for the newly installed hard disk drive to be recognized. See
“Hot-swap-drive status LEDs” on page 44. If the hard disk drive is faulty, you need to reinstall or
replace it until it is operating correctly.

7. Do one of the following:

• If you are installing a hot-swap hard disk drive, save the removed dummy hard-disk-drive tray in case

that you later remove the hot-swap hard disk drive and need a dummy tray to cover the drive bay.

• If you are replacing a hot-swap hard disk drive and are instructed to return the old hot-swap hard

disk drive, follow all packaging instructions and use any packaging materials that are supplied to
you for shipping.

What to do next:

• To work with another piece of hardware, go to the appropriate section.

• To configure RAID, go to “Configuring RAID” on page 56.

Installing or replacing a 2.5-inch solid-state drive

You can install or replace a hot-swap solid-state drive without turning off the server, which helps you avoid
significant interruption to the operation of the system.

The EMI integrity and cooling of the server are protected by having all drive bays covered or occupied. The
number of the installed hard disk drives or solid-state drives in your server varies depending on the server
model. The vacant bays are occupied by dummy hard-disk-drive trays. When you install a hot-swap hard
disk drive or solid-state drive, save the removed dummy hard-disk-drive tray from the drive bay in case
that you later remove the hot-swap hard disk drive or solid-state drive and need the dummy tray to cover
the place.
